類名稱 |
描述 |
如何添加 |
CBCGPAnalogClockCtrl |
使用嵌入式模擬時鐘計控制。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PAnalogClockCtrl替換CStatic
|
CBCGPAnimCtrl |
控件顯示一組具有指定幀速率的位圖。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PAnimCtrl替換CStatic
|
CBCGPButton |
提供標準Windows按鈕控件的擴展功能的控件。它包括新的外觀和感覺樣式,對齊文本的各種方法,組合圖像和文本的能力,設置光標和工具提示。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PButton替換CButton
|
CBCGPBrushButton |
刷子按鈕來自常規按鈕控件,并在左側顯示畫筆預覽。當用戶單擊此按鈕時,將出現模態畫筆編輯對話框。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PBrushButton替換CButton
|
CBCGPBreadcrumb |
允許用戶瀏覽分層數據的控件,例如應用程序定義的庫或文件目錄。可以將其與不一次顯示整個項目樹的樹視圖控件進行比較。 |
- 將Edit控件添加到對話框中(1)
- 為此控件定義CEdit成員變量(2)
- 用.H文件中的CBCGPBreadcrumb替換CEdit
|
CBCGPCalculator |
實現算術計算器功能的控件。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PCalculator成員變量添加到對話框類(例如,m_wndCalc)
- 在OnInitDialog中創建控件:m_wndCalc.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PCalendar |
實現日歷控制功能的控件。控件可以一次顯示幾個月。根據控件大小自動計算顯示的月數。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PCalendar成員變量添加到對話框類(例如,m_wndCalendar)
- 在OnInitDialog中創建控件:m_wndCalendar.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PChartCtrl |
封裝Chart可視對象的控件,它覆蓋控件的客戶區域。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PChartCtrl替換CStatic
|
CBCGPCheckListBox |
具有視覺主題,標題和“固定”項目支持的擴展檢查列表框控件 |
- 在對話框中添加一個列表框(1)。此控件應具有“owner-draw”和“has strings”樣式。
- 為此控件定義CListBox成員變量(2)
- 用.H文件中的CBCGPCheckListBox替換CListBox
|
CBCGPCircularGaugeCtrl |
采用嵌入式圓形儀表控制。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PCircularGaugeCtrl替換CStatic
|
CBCGPCircularProgressIndicatorCtrl |
使用嵌入式循環進度指示器控制 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PCircularProgressIndicatorCtrl替換CStatic
|
CBCGPColorBar |
辦公風格的調色板。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PColorBar成員變量添加到對話框類(例如,m_wndColorBar)
- 在OnInitDialog中創建控件:m_wndColorBar.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PColorButton |
辦公風格的顏色選擇器。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PColorButton替換CButton
|
CBCGPColorComboBox |
實現所有者繪制組合框的控件,其下拉列表包含左側帶有顏色框的顏色名稱。 |
- 在對話框中添加一個組合框。此控件應具有“owner-draw”和“has strings”樣式。
- 為此控件定義CComboBox成員變量(2)
- 用.H文件中的CBCGPColorComboBox替換CComboBox
|
CBCGPComboBox |
使用Visual Theme實現組合框控件繪制的控件。它還旨在支持“Aero Glass”上的繪圖。 |
- 在對話框中添加一個組合框。此控件應具有“owner-draw”和“has strings”樣式。
- 為此控件定義CComboBox成員變量(2)
- 用.H文件中的CBCGPComboBox替換CComboBox
|
CBCGPDateTimeCtrl |
日期/時間選擇器 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PDateTimeCtrl替換CButton
|
CBCGPDurationCtrl |
持續時間控制 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PDurationCtrl替換CButton
|
CBCGPDiagramVisualContainerCtrl |
圖容器控件 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PDiagramVisualContainerCtrl替換CStatic
|
CBCGPEdit |
使用瀏覽按鈕和搜索框功能編輯控件。 |
- 將Edit控件添加到對話框中(1)
- 為此控件定義CEdit成員變量(2)
- 用.H文件中的CBCGPEdit替換CEdit
|
CBCGPEditCtrl |
高級編輯控件,具有語法突出顯示,標記,輪廓(可折疊節點)和IntelliSense支持。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PEditCtrl成員變量添加到對話框類(例如,m_wndEdit)
- 在OnInitDialog中創建控件:m_wndEdit.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PEditListBox |
帶有標題和“新建”,“刪除”,“向上”和“向下”按鈕的可編輯列表框 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PEditListBox替換CStatic
|
CBCGPFontComboBox |
字體選擇器控件 |
- 在對話框中添加一個組合框
- 為此控件定義CComboBox成員變量(2)
- 用.H文件中的CBCGPFontComboBox替換CComboBox
|
CBCGPGridCtrl |
高級網格和報告控制 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PGridCtrl成員變量添加到對話框類(例如,m_wndGrid)
- 在OnInitDialog中創建控件:m_wndGrid.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PHotSpotImageCtrl |
使用包含可點擊的矩形區域(熱點)的背景圖像進行控制。當用戶單擊熱點時,控件將帶有BN_CLICKED代碼的WM_COMMAND消息發送給父節點。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PHotSpotImageCtrl替換CButton
|
CBCGPKnobCtrl |
控制模擬數字旋鈕功能。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PKnobCtrl替換CStatic
|
CBCGPLinearGaugeCtrl |
采用嵌入式線性規控制。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PLinearGaugeCtrl替換CStatic
|
CBCGPLineStyleComboBox |
具有預定義線條樣式集的組合框,例如實線,點或短劃線。 |
- 在對話框中添加一個組合框(1)
- 為此控件定義CComboBox成員變量(2)
- 用.H文件中的CBCGPLineStyleComboBox替換CComboBox
|
CBCGPListBox |
具有視覺主題,標題和“fix”項目支持的擴展列表框控件 |
- 在對話框中添加一個列表框(1)。此控件應具有“owner-draw”和“has strings”樣式。
- 為此控件定義CListBox成員變量(2)
- 用.H文件中的CBCGPListBox替換CListBox
|
CBCGPListCtrl |
具有視覺主題支持的擴展列表控件。 |
- 將List控件添加到對話框中(1)
- 為此控件定義CListCtrl成員變量(2)
- 用.H文件中的CBCGPListCtrl替換CListCtrl
|
CBCGPMaskEdit |
擴展編輯控件,能夠根據指定的掩碼驗證鍵入的字符,并根據指定的模板顯示它們。 |
- 將Edit控件添加到對話框中(1)
- 為此控件定義CEdit成員變量(2)
- 用.H文件中的CBCGPMaskEdit替換CEdit
|
CBCGPMenuButton |
提供按鈕功能的控件,單擊時顯示彈出菜單,并將選定的命令重定向到父級。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PMenuButton替換CButton
|
CBCGPProgressCtrl |
通過視覺主題支持擴展進度控制。 |
- 將Progress控件添加到對話框中(1)
- 為此控件定義CProgressCtrl成員變量(2)
- 用.H文件中的CBCGPProgressCtrl替換CProgressCtrl
|
CBCGPPropertySheetCtrl |
物業單控制。 |
- 將不可見的空圖片控件(占位符)添加到對話框中(1)
- 將CBCGPPropertySheetCtrl成員變量添加到對話框類(例如,m_wndPropSheet)
- 將控件初始化代碼添加到OnInitDialog:
m_wndPropSheet.m_bIsAutoDestroy = FALSE;
m_wndPropSheet.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PPropList |
具有嵌入式工具欄,搜索框,多級層次結構,項狀態,命令和描述的高級屬性網格控件。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PPropList成員變量添加到對話框類(例如,m_wndPropList)
- 在OnInitDialog中創建控件:m_wndPropList.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PRotationCtrl |
旋轉控制源自“徑向”菜單,適用于3D對象(例如3D中的圖表)視圖。 |
- 將空圖片控件(占位符)添加到對話框中(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PRotationCtrl替換CStatic
|
CBCGPRadialMenu |
徑向菜單控制 |
- 將空圖片控件(占位符)添加到對話框中(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PRadialMenu替換CStatic
|
CBCGPScrollBar |
具有視覺主題支持的滾動條控件。 |
- 在對話框中添加滾動條(1)
- 為此控件定義CScrollBar成員變量(2)
- 將CScrollBar替換為.H文件中的CBCGPScrollBar
|
CBCGPShellBreadcrumb |
Explorer風格的shell breadcrumb控件。 |
- 驗證您是否添加了對“InitShellManager();”的調用 在您的應用程序的開頭InitInstance()
- 將Edit控件添加到對話框中(1)
- 為此控件定義CEdit成員變量(2)
- 用.H文件中的CBCGPShellBreadcrumb替換CEdit
|
CBCGPShellList |
資源管理器風格的shell列表控件。 |
- 驗證您是否添加了對“InitShellManager();”的調用 在您的應用程序的開頭InitInstance()
- 將List控件添加到對話框中(1)
- 為此控件定義CListCtrl成員變量(2)
- 將CListCtrl替換為.H文件中的CBCGPShellList
|
CBCGPShellTree |
資源管理器風格的shell樹視圖。 |
- 驗證您是否添加了對“InitShellManager();”的調用 在您的應用程序的開頭InitInstance()
- 將Tree控件添加到對話框中(1)
- 為此控件定義CTreeCtrl成員變量(2)
- 用.H文件中的CBCGPShellTree替換CTreeCtrl
|
CBCGPSpinButtonCtrl |
通過視覺主題支持旋轉(“向上/向下”)控制。 |
- 向對話框添加旋轉(“向上/向下”)控件(1)
- 為此控件定義CSpinButtonCtrl成員變量(2)
- 用.H文件中的CBCGPSpinButtonCtrl替換CSpinButtonCtrl
|
CBCGPSwitchCtrl |
“開/關”儀表具有不同的形狀和視覺主題。 |
- 在對話框中添加一個空的Picture控件(占位符)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PSwitchCtrl替換CStatic
|
CBCGPTabWnd |
“高級”選項卡控件提供了允許創建選項卡式窗口小部件的功能。 |
- 將不可見的空圖片控件(占位符)添加到對話框編輯器(1)
- 將CBCGPTabWnd成員變量添加到對話框類(例如,m_wndTab)
- 在OnInitDialog中創建控件:m_wndTab.CreateOnPlaceHolder(this,id_of_placeholder,id_of_control,style);
|
CBCGPTagCloudCtrl |
標簽云控件是文本數據(“標簽”)的可視化表示,每個標簽的重要性以字體大小或顏色顯示。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PTagCloudCtrl替換CStatic
|
CBCGPTreeCtrl |
具有視覺主題支持的擴展樹控件。 |
- 將Tree控件添加到對話框中(1)
- 為此控件定義CTreeCtrl成員變量(2)
- 用.H文件中的CBCGPTreeCtrl替換CTreeCtrl
|
CBCGPTreeMapCtrl |
樹圖是層次結構的空間約束可視化。它使用大小和顏色顯示葉節點的屬性。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PTreeMapCtrl替換CStatic
|
CBCGPURLLinkBut??ton |
超鏈接控制。 |
- 在對話框中添加一個Button(1)
- 為此控件定義CButton成員變量(2)
- 用.H文件中的CBCGPURLLinkBut??ton替換CButton
|
CBCGPWinUITilesCtrl |
實現類似Windows 8的磁貼的控件。 |
- 在對話框中添加一個空的Picture控件(占位符)(1)
- 為此控件定義CStatic成員變量(2)
- 用.H文件中的CBCGPWinUITilesCtrl替換CStatic
|